草庐IT

Android:Google Playstore 的公测

全部标签

Android Studio 开发一个完整的APP实例

AndroidStudio开发一个完整的APP实例随着移动应用程序的普及和需求的增长,Android操作系统成为最受欢迎的移动平台之一。在Android开发中,AndroidStudio是最流行和功能强大的集成开发环境(IDE)。本文将介绍如何使用AndroidStudio开发一个完整的APP实例。首先,我们需要确保已经安装了最新版本的AndroidStudio。然后,我们可以开始创建一个新的项目。创建新项目打开AndroidStudio,点击"StartanewAndroidStudioproject"来创建一个新的项目。在新建项目窗口中,输入应用程序名称和包名,选择目标API级别和项目模板

02 java ---- Android 基础app开发

目录相对布局显示一个美女 显示两个美女安卓APP启动过程安卓布局控件常用布局之相对布局常用布局之相对布局padding和margin按键美化 常用布局之线性布局安卓按键响应的几种方式直接设置按键的onClick绑定的函数自定义类实现按键监听事件的接口匿名内部类实现按键响应mainActivity实现了oclick接口页面跳转如何跳转Intent配合onclick如何传参方式一直接putExtra传参数如何传参方式二通过Bundle搭配putExtras安卓线程Activity(页面)的生命周期面试常考点安卓网络编程 javaSocket服务端开发JavaSocket客户端开发:安卓app中创建

偷流量、端口占用、网络负载高、socket创建释放异常等Android高阶TCP/IP网络问题定位思路

一,背景通常一些偷流量、端口占用、网络负载高、socket创建释放异常等Android网络相关问题,可以通过使用tcpdump抓tcp/ip报文,来定位。但是tcpdump无进程信息,也没有APK包名信息,无法确认异常的报文来自哪些Apk或者native进程。本题解决tcpdump报文无法关联到哪个进程/APK的问题。二,tcpdumptcpdump是该类问题基本的工具。在此仅作简单介绍。tcpdumptcp-ieth1-t-s0-c100anddstport!22andsrcnet192.168.0.1/24-C60-W15-w/data/....tupdump使用参数说明tcpipicmp

Android Studio中膨胀布局的错误

我想通过夸大不同的布局来添加listView中的页脚。这是我的代码...ViewloadMoreView,loading_img;loading_img=((LayoutInflater)this.getSystemService(Context.LAYOUT_INFLATER_SERVICE)).inflate(R.layout.loading_img,null,false);loadMoreView=((LayoutInflater)this.getSystemService(Context.LAYOUT_INFLATER_SERVICE)).inflate(R.layout.load_m

Android Studio-如何在编辑器中制作R.String显示文本

有时,在活动或XML中,AndroidStudio编辑器直接显示为特定R.String映射的文本,当我单击该文本时,它会更改为R.String。<>。几次,我看到Activity或XML编辑器显示R.String。看答案您需要在首选项下启用它->编辑->一般->代码折叠。它(据我所记得的)“AndroidString引用”。请注意,您必须关闭/重新打开此设置的XML以“显示”。您可以看到它的外观(由于“公司原因”,某些代码已被“红色胶带”,但您甚至可以看到如何@dimen/xxx和@string/xxx在里面contentDescription已经扩大了。

Android 刷机

Android刷机TWRP使用adbsideload线刷ROM的方法线刷流程:fastboot刷入官方包刷机流程问题安装完成后无法获取root权限安装magisk并root网络问题wifi无法使用:安装charler证书关于权限问题的解决Android投屏神器本文本使用到的资源链接:网盘分享前提概念:线刷:使用USB线连接PC进行刷机卡刷:使用手机自身的内存、内置SD(自带磁盘)进行刷机。TWRP使用adbsideload线刷ROM的方法前提:刷机之前需要安装的TWRP这个神器工具刷入TWRP教程ROM与支持的设备Nexus和Pixel设备的完整OTA映像线刷流程:第一步:在计算机上,打开命令

Android开发 Button setOnClickListener

1.ButtonButton是TextView的子类区别: 直接写两个内容相同、属性相同的TextView和Button对比如下:效果: 在Button中英文字母是否全部大写可以由属性textAllCaps控制。新增属性onClick可以指定点击Button后跳转的方法,不过该属性已经过时,可以使用但不推荐代码:xml文件代码:对应的activity.java文件代码:packagecom.example.study;importandroidx.appcompat.app.AppCompatActivity;importandroid.os.Bundle;importandroid.view

Android用户目前面临的六大安全威胁​

如今,各种出色的Android设备已能让我们无缝地利用生活中的碎片时间,开展各类工作、娱乐、创作、以及交流等活动。不过,目前随着越来越多的安全威胁在我们没注意到或看不见的角落里暗流涌动,时常会危及我们的数据、隐私、甚至是Android设备本身的安全。下面,我将和您深入讨论Android设备用户时常面临的6大安全威胁,并逐一给出对策。1.恶意软件根据Securelist的报告,仅在2023年第二季度,卡巴斯基就阻止了570多万起恶意软件、广告软件、以及风险软件(Riskware)对于各类Android设备的直接攻击。其中,最普遍的现象之一是:那些潜在不需要的程序(PotentiallyUnwan

Android service介绍——startService和bindService基本使用(1)

Androidservice介绍——startService和bindService基本使用(1)问题背景在安卓日常开发和学习中,经常会使用到Service,它是Android四大组件之一。使用Service可以在后台执行长时间的操作(performlong-runningoperationsinthebackground),Service并不与用户产生UI交互。其他的应用组件可以启动Service,即便用户切换了其他应用,启动的Service仍可在后台运行。一个组件可以与Service绑定并与之交互,甚至是跨进程通信(IPC)。例如,一个Service可以在后台执行网络请求、播放音乐、执行文

Android keymint(keymaster)一RKP

whatisRKPRKPisremotekeyprovisioing.whyRKP以前我们生产手机平板项目的时候,是从Google申请attestationkey(googlekey),在产线使用工具写入手机或平板设备中。这种写入的方式有一个安全隐患:从Google申请的证书和密钥,有私钥泄露的隐患,因此从AndroidS开始,google提出了一个RKP的做法。简单来说:从设备里边生成密钥;导出生产的公钥;以CSR的形式上传到google服务器;HowtodoRKP参考Google的指导文档,在AOSP源码中提供了一个参考工具的实现:system/security/provisioner下边